Join Emmy® Award-winning, Michael-Ann Rowe as she returns with her food & travel documentary series, “Off the Beaten Palate.” Michael-Ann narrates as she explores two more Canadian provinces discovering culture through food — it’s an adventure and authentic experience!

Michael-Ann interviews local personalities that define and distinguish Canadian Culture as she delves into the interior of Ontario and Alberta. In Ontario she kicks off her adventure at the top of the CN Tower, attempting the “Edge Walk”!  She explores parts of Ontario’s ‘Golden Horseshoe’ region and learns how the Niagara Escarpment provides the province with its unique rich soil. In Alberta she explores a province that boasts a ‘Rocky Mountain’ lifestyle, two metropolitan cities and the golden prairie landscape; Michael-Ann learns how to rope a cow by a professional rancher, meets ‘the Beef Geek’ and learns why Canadian Bacon, Beef and Bison are so special. Along these adventures, Michael-Ann shares some amazing recipes that exemplifies, ‘eating local’ and ‘sustainability’, Off the Beaten Palate!

Michael-Ann has been nominated five times for the Taste Awards, won Best Media Journalist at Canadian Blog Awards and most recently, won an Emmy® Award for this series.
